NBA Playoff Predictions Breakdown Experts Analyze Strengths and Weaknesses in Every Second Round Matchup

As the second round of the NBA playoffs heats up, experts remain sharply divided on the key matchups, especially the fiercely contested Knicks vs. 76ers series. The Knicks bring a gritty defensive presence led by Julius Randle, whose ability to control the paint and rebound is crucial. However, Philadelphia’s offensive versatility, spearheaded by Joel Embiid’s dominance inside and James Harden’s playmaking, creates matchup nightmares for New York. Analysts emphasize that the series could tilt on which team executes better in clutch moments and limits turnovers.

Strengths and Weaknesses Breakdown:

  • Knicks: Disciplined defense, strong bench depth, vulnerability to perimeter shooting
  • 76ers: Elite scoring options, home-court advantage, inconsistent perimeter defense

Knicks Versus 76ers Preview Contested Battle Leaves Analysts Divided on Key Factors and Outcomes

As the Knicks and 76ers gear up for their highly anticipated second-round clash, analysts remain sharply divided on which side holds the upper hand. Both teams boast formidable rosters, but it’s the contrasting styles that make this matchup unpredictable. New York’s tenacious defense and relentless pace have tested opponents all season, while Philadelphia relies heavily on star performances and dominant interior presence. Key factors likely to influence the series outcome include the battle on the boards, three-point shooting efficiency, and how well each team’s role players step up under pressure.

Experts are highlighting several critical matchups and strategic questions:

  • Can Julius Randle sustain his offensive production against a disciplined 76ers frontcourt?
  • Will Joel Embiid’s physicality and interior scoring prove too much for the Knicks’ defense?
  • Which bench unit can provide timely scoring and stability during crunch moments?
  • How will coaching adjustments impact momentum swings throughout the series?

Strategic Recommendations and Dark Horse Picks Insights From Leading Basketball Experts on Advancing Teams

Industry experts remain sharply divided as they dissect the nuances of every second-round matchup, particularly spotlighting the fierce contest between the Knicks and 76ers. While Philadelphia boasts a potent offensive arsenal led by Joel Embiid, strategic caution is advised given New York’s gritty defense and emerging sharpshooters. Several analysts recommend leaning into adjustments on rotation and defensive schemes to counter the Sixers’ inside dominance, advocating for quicker perimeter closeouts and more aggressive ball pressure to stifle Embiid’s rhythm.

Beyond the marquee encounters, dark horse picks have caught the collective eye of basketball insiders. Teams like the Miami Heat and Dallas Mavericks have been spotlighted for their balanced lineups and adaptability under pressure, potentially upsetting the conventional bracket predictions. Coaches and analysts underscore the importance of:

  • Depth utilization: Leveraging bench production to sustain intensity across quarters.
  • Matchup exploitation: Capitalizing on favorable defensive mismatches.
  • Clutch execution: Elevating decision-making in high-stakes moments.
